Abstract
A system that solves a global inequality constrained optimization problem specified by a function ƒ and a set of inequality constraints p(x)≦0(i=1, . . . , m), wherein ƒ and pare scalar functions of a vector x=(x, x, x, . . . x). The system performs an interval inequality constrained global optimization process to compute guaranteed bounds on a globally minimum value of the function ƒ(x) subject to the set of inequality constraints. The system applies term consistency and box consistency to a set of relations associated with the global inequality constrained optimization problem over a subbox X, and excludes any portion of the subbox X that violates the set of relations. The system also performs an interval Newton step on the subbox X to produce a resulting subbox Y. The system integrates the sub-parts of the process with branch tests designed to increase the overall speed of the process.
